It could possibly be the Profile causing the drop in alkalinity. Someone
on the list, I think it was Wayne, had this same problem a few months ago
and it was traced to the Profile substrate. Nitrates also appeared along
with the KH/pH drop. Have you tested the nitrate level in the tank?
I would look to the substrate before suspecting the driftwood unless the
wood's been soaked in a strong acid at some point. I suppose it's
possible, but IMHO, it would take a tremendous amount of fungal activity to
drop the KH from 11 to 4 degrees in 4 days.
